Frequently Asked Questions about Texarkana

What type of rentals are currently available in Texarkana?

There are currently 73 Apartments for Rent in Texarkana, AR with pricing that ranges from $600 to $2,150. There are also 38 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Texarkana ranging from $790 to $4,500.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Texarkana?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Texarkana ranges from $790 to $4,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,639.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Texarkana?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Texarkana range from $900 to $2,150,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$950 to $4,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,300 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,275.
